Michael Houlihan and Bonnie Harvey founded Barefoot Cellars in their laundry room in 1986. Starting with no money and no knowledge of the business, they developed strategic alliances, innovative marketing and an entrepreneurial culture to overcome formidable obstacles in the highly competitive and controlled wine industry. In 2005, they sold Barefoot Wine. Barefoot is now the #1 wine brand in the world.
